I live in Utah.

In 2016 my wife and son got their mail-in ballots, but mine never arrived. My neighbor who is a lawyer and Democratic activist was checking the county voter registration rolls and noticed that mine had been mailed to a PO Box in a town 50 miles away. It was an address that I had not used in 20 years. And for the last 20 years, until 2016, I had always gotten my ballot at my current address.

When I went to the county clerk's office they said, oops, the voter rolls had been updated and somehow they had gone back to an address I hadn't used in 20 years. Old addresses had been used for quite a few local voters.

Now...I tend to think that this was some kind of clerical error. But living in a state that is overwhelmingly Republican and where the party controls almost everything, it's impossible not to feel a little paranoid about such things.
